On-screen fingerprint sensors are easy to fool
Many are the users who support the arrival of the fingerprint sensors on the screen to the current terminals, but there are also many other people who have decided not to bet on these components. Similarly, the current trend will eventually impose these readers on all market terminals. It seems to us personally that it is a good technology that is in the process of development and is still missing a few years to reach the usual sensors. Well, it seems that not only is it about speed, but they can also be much lower in security.
A report published by XDA Developers has confirmed how easy it is to deceive these types of sensors. For this, only a transparent film of those that are usually used to wrap food and a little ink is necessary. In the video, you can see how the terminal is unlocked with the mere impression of the print on the transparent film. Then, all you have to do is press a little and you can now access the device with total freedom. In this process, the most complicated thing would be to obtain the footprint in question, from there everything becomes the simplest task in the world.
It should be noted that this method has also been used with conventional sensors located on the back and side of the terminals and the results have been completely different. It is also important to note that this procedure does not have to work on all devices. Everything seems to indicate that the safety of the new sensors is not at the level that tradition readers can have, so the question we must ask ourselves is: are fingerprint sensors safe on the screen?
